Output 89003ed25ec8f35d3b6f66d314f532eab5eca4e5dfd0d2c84fe8e73bc07c350c:0

value
28146362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bb7fa5ad6153b6fc24efad75c44e5b685d2e384 OP_EQUAL
address
3LGBVVo9zjAiqrwHt7spgYR6ydok9g4iNr
transaction
89003ed25ec8f35d3b6f66d314f532eab5eca4e5dfd0d2c84fe8e73bc07c350c
confirmations
310979
spent
true